Compliance requirements
The bidder must confirm the standard exclusion grounds, including no final convictions in the last five years for participation in a criminal organisation, corruption, fraud, terrorist offences or related crimes, and other exclusion grounds listed in the tender documents. If an exclusion ground exists, the bidder may be allowed to provide evidence of self-cleaning where the procurement rules and tender documents allow it. The machine-readable notice does not provide the full list in plain language, so the exact exclusion grounds and any required confirmations must be checked in the official tender documents.
Qualification criteria and exclusion grounds
The bidder must meet the qualification requirements in the tender documents. The machine-readable notice states that the bidder’s average annual net turnover in web development for the last three completed financial years must be at least EUR 60,000. The bidder must provide the turnover data for the relevant period 01.01.2023–31.12.2025 and, if requested and not publicly available, the last three annual reports or extracts. The bidder must also show at least two completed Drupal-based website maintenance, support and/or development contracts or orders from the 36 months before the start of the procurement, each worth at least EUR 10,000 excluding VAT. For these references, the bidder must provide the subject, value, dates, counterparty details and, in a public procurement, the reference number. If the contract is still ongoing, only the completed part within the reference period counts. The bidder may also need to submit the technical solution and vision document required by the compliance conditions.
